Professional Certificate in Negotiation for Community Outreach
-- ViewingNowThe Professional Certificate in Negotiation for Community Outreach is a course designed to empower learners with the skills necessary to drive impactful change in their communities. This program emphasizes the importance of negotiation in conflict resolution, partnership building, and advancing community initiatives.

In the UK, the demand for professionals skilled in negotiation for community outreach is on the rise.
With increasing social challenges and a growing need for community development, various roles require outstanding negotiation skills to drive impact and create change.
Let's explore some popular job titles and their respective representation in the job market: 1. Community Development Manager: These professionals are responsible for developing and implementing strategies that improve local communities.
A 25% share of the market indicates a strong demand for negotiation experts in this role. 2. Social Services Manager: Managing social service programs and coordinating with various stakeholders calls for refined negotiation skills.
A 20% share highlights the importance of negotiation in this job. 3. Nonprofit Program Manager: With an 18% share, these professionals need negotiation skills to secure partnerships, resources, and positive outcomes for their organizations. 4. Policy Analyst: These experts require negotiation skills to influence policy decisions and navigate complex political landscapes, representing 15% of the market. 5. Community Outreach Coordinator: Securing support, resources, and collaborations for community initiatives requires solid negotiation abilities, reflecting a 12% share. 6. Grant Writer: Obtaining funding for community projects relies heavily on successful negotiations.
This role accounts for 10% of the job market.
With the right negotiation skills, professionals can enhance their career prospects in community outreach and make a significant difference in local communities.
